K. Muneeswaran is a scholar working on Artificial Intelligence, Computer Networks and Communications and Information Systems. According to data from OpenAlex, K. Muneeswaran has authored 24 papers receiving a total of 408 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Artificial Intelligence, 9 papers in Computer Networks and Communications and 9 papers in Information Systems. Recurrent topics in K. Muneeswaran's work include Web Data Mining and Analysis (5 papers), Text and Document Classification Technologies (5 papers) and Spam and Phishing Detection (3 papers). K. Muneeswaran is often cited by papers focused on Web Data Mining and Analysis (5 papers), Text and Document Classification Technologies (5 papers) and Spam and Phishing Detection (3 papers). K. Muneeswaran collaborates with scholars based in United States and India. K. Muneeswaran's co-authors include T. Revathi, K. Ramar, Ganesh Chandrasekaran, K. Vijayalakshmi, R. Uma, B. Lakshmanan, M. Bhuvaneswari and G. Priyanka and has published in prestigious journals such as Scientific Reports, Expert Systems with Applications and Applied Soft Computing.
